A Grand Entrance: The Architecture of Wonder 🏛️🌟
As you step through the grand entrance of the Natural History Museum, you’re immediately transported to a different era. The museum’s Victorian Gothic architecture, designed by Alfred Waterhouse, is a masterpiece in itself. The intricate terracotta tiles and the soaring ceilings create an atmosphere of awe and curiosity. 🏛️👀 It’s as if the building itself is telling a story, inviting you to explore its secrets. 📜🔍
From Dinosaurs to Diamonds: Unveiling the Exhibits 🦕💎
The heart of the Natural History Museum lies in its exhibits, which span millions of years of Earth’s history. The Dinosaur Gallery is a must-see, featuring the iconic Diplodocus skeleton, affectionately known as "Dippy." 🦕✨ But there’s much more to discover. The Human Evolution gallery offers a fascinating look at our own species’ journey, while the Earth Galleries delve into the planet’s geological wonders, from volcanoes to precious gems. 🌋💎 Each exhibit is designed to engage and educate, making complex scientific concepts accessible and exciting. 🧪🚀

Conservation and Research: Looking to the Future 🌱🔬
Beyond its role as a public attraction, the Natural History Museum is a hub of scientific research and conservation efforts. Scientists at the museum work tirelessly to study and protect the natural world, from cataloging new species to monitoring environmental changes. 🌍📊 The museum’s commitment to sustainability and education ensures that future generations will continue to benefit from its vast knowledge and resources. 🌱📚 As we face global challenges like climate change and biodiversity loss, the museum’s work is more important than ever. 🌍💪
